Meeting European Demands for Recycled Content

With EU regulations requiring 30% recycled content in PET bottles by 2030, and 1.4 million tonnes of recycled PET already being used for food-contact packaging, manufacturers are racing to develop cost-effective ways to validate r-PET for use in their processes.

However, variations in flake quality, high cost compared to virgin material, and the need for major equipment adaptation remain key hurdles. To address these, fast and accurate lab-scale testing has become an essential part of R&D for recyclers and converters alike.

A Smarter Way to Test r-PET

The Microex Cast system is engineered specifically for extrusion testing using PET flakes, removing the need for regranulation and allowing trials that better reflect real-world production.

Key features include:

  • Low sample requirement: Run tests with as little as 300g of material, minimising waste and expense.
  • Direct flake feeding: Forced dosing system enables direct use of r-PET flakes, simulating real production conditions.
  • In-line defect detection: Built-in visual system categorises imperfections in real-time, helping to optimise feedstock and fine-tune processes.
  • Thermo-regulated calender: Allows greater process flexibility and supports a wide range of testing scenarios.
